Westminster Diocese announces clergy moves and changes for 2024

<br>Mgr Martin Hayes, Vicar General of the Diocese of Westminster, has issued the following information about forthcoming retirements, priests' appointments and deacons' placements for this year.<br><br><strong>RETIREMENTS<br></strong><br><strong>Fr John Deehan</strong>&nbsp;-&nbsp;<strong>from Kentish Town</strong>, summer 2024<br><strong>Fr Dennis Touw</strong>&nbsp;- from&nbsp;<strong>Fulham 1</strong>, summer 2024<br><br><strong>PARISH PRIESTS<br></strong><br><strong>Fr Bernard Akoeso OSB</strong>&nbsp;- Holy Cross,&nbsp;<strong>Parsons Green&nbsp;</strong>from sabbatical<br><strong>Fr Allan Alvarado Gil</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ady Help of Christians,&nbsp;<strong>Kentish Town</strong>&nbsp;from Assistant Priest, Willesden Green and Kensal Rise<br><strong>Fr John Byrne</strong>&nbsp;- Corpus Christi,&nbsp;<strong>Tring</strong>&nbsp;from Parish Priest, Feltham<br><strong>Fr Saviour Grech</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ady of Perpetual Help,&nbsp;<strong>Fulham 2</strong>, Stephendale Road from sabbatical<br><strong>Fr Mike Maguire</strong>&nbsp;- St Lawrence,&nbsp;<strong>Feltham</strong>&nbsp;from Precentor, Westminster Cathedral<br><strong>Fr James Neal</strong>&nbsp;- St Thomas of Canterbury,&nbsp;<strong>Fulham</strong>&nbsp;from sabbatical<br><strong>Fr Pascal Sullivan CCN</strong>&nbsp;- Christ the King,&nbsp;<strong>Cockfosters</strong>&nbsp;from Assistant Priest at Cockfosters, in succession to Fr Christophe Brunet&nbsp;<strong>CCN</strong>&nbsp;from 1 August 2024<br><strong>Fr Nigel Woollen</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ady of Victories,&nbsp;<strong>Kensington 1</strong>&nbsp;from Assistant Priest, Stevenage parishes<br><br><strong>PAROCHIAL ADMINISTRATOR<br></strong><br><strong>Fr Tom O'Brien AA</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ady Immaculate and St Andrew,&nbsp;<strong>Hitchin</strong>&nbsp;from 1 June 2024<br><br><strong>ASSISTANT PRIESTS, FIRST APPOINTMENTS FOLLOWING ORDINATION ON 29 JUNE 2024</strong><br><br><strong>Fr Thomas Blackburn</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ady of Lourdes,&nbsp;<strong>New Southgate</strong><br><strong>Fr Domagoj Matokovic</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ady Help of Christians,&nbsp;<strong>Rickmansworth</strong>, St John Fisher,&nbsp;<strong>Chorleywood</strong>&nbsp;and St John the Evangelist,&nbsp;<strong>Mill End</strong><br><strong>Fr Robert Smialek</strong>&nbsp;- St Joseph, Transfiguration, St Hilda,&nbsp;<strong>Stevenage Parishes</strong><br><br><strong>ASSISTANT PRIESTS<br></strong><br><strong>Fr Matteo Di Giuseppe</strong>&nbsp;- St Mary Magdalen,&nbsp;<strong>Willesden Green</strong>&nbsp;and Church of the Transfiguration,&nbsp;<strong>Kensal Rise</strong>. Resident at Kensal Rise from Assistant Priest, Rickmansworth, Chorleywood and Mill End<br><strong>Fr Axcel Soriano</strong>&nbsp;- Our Lady of Mount Carmel and St George,&nbsp;<strong>Enfield</strong>&nbsp;from Assistant Priest, Harrow North<br><strong>Fr Patrick van der Vorst</strong>&nbsp;-&nbsp;<strong>Precentor, Westminster Cathedral</strong>&nbsp;from Assistant Priest, Enfield<br><br><strong>DEACONS IN FORMATION FOR PRIESTHOOD, ORDAINED ON 15 JUNE 2024</strong><br><br><strong>Rev James Boyle</strong>&nbsp;- Holy Trinity,&nbsp;<strong>Brook Green</strong><br><strong>Rev Sean Power&nbsp;</strong>- Our Lady and St Vincent,&nbsp;<strong>Potters Bar</strong><br><br>Note: Appointments are taken up at the beginning of September, by local agreement. Costs associated with moving are met by the parish of departure.<br><br><strong>SABBATICAL<br></strong><br><strong>Fr Andrew O'Connell</strong>&nbsp;- from Assistant Priest, New Southgate<br><strong>Fr John McKenna</strong>&nbsp;- from Parish Priest, Barnet<br><br>Mary Immaculate and St Gregory the Great,&nbsp;<strong>Barnet&nbsp;</strong>will be entrusted to the care of the Consolata Missionary Fathers (IMC), Province of the Generalate, from the beginning of September 2024<br><br><strong>CATHOLIC CHILDRENS SOCIETY</strong><br><br><strong>Fr David Reilly</strong>&nbsp;- Chair from 11 June 2024 in succession to&nbsp;<strong>Fr Michael Daley RIP</strong><br><br><strong>PERMANENT DEACONS TO BE ORDAINED ON 6 JULY 2024</strong><br><br><strong>Paul Hewitt</strong>, Our Lady of Victories,&nbsp;<strong>Kensington 1</strong><br><strong>James Sin</strong>, St John Fisher,&nbsp;<strong>Harrow North</strong><br><strong>Eze Ugoala</strong>, Sacred Heart of Jesus,&nbsp;<strong>Holloway</strong><br><br><em>Independent Catholic News (ICN</em>) <a href="https://www.indcatholicnews.com/news/50072"><mark style="background-color:rgba(0, 0, 0, 0)" class="has-inline-color has-vivid-cyan-blue-color">reports</mark></a> Mgr Martin commenting: "The Cardinal is grateful to the priests who are taking up new appointments and he thanks them for their service in their current appointments. Gratitude is expressed to Fr John Deehan and Fr Dennis Touw as they prepare for retirement, with the prayers and best wishes of us all for a long and happy retirement."<br><br>He concludes: "We pray for those to be ordained to the priesthood on Saturday and to the permanent diaconate on Saturday week."<em><br><br>Photo: British mosaic artist Basil Cary-Elwes at work in an arched window laying the gilded mosaic pieces in the Lady Chapel of Westminster Cathedral, London, England, June 1935.
